### Export Memory — Runbook

Gridvane spreadsheet exports stream rows; memory spikes mean streaming fell back to buffered mode. Check EXPORT_STREAM_ENABLED=true and EXPORT_ROW_CHUNK=2000. Anything above 1.5 GB RSS per worker warrants a restart. Exports are encrypted at rest before pickup, and the encryption key the worker loads at boot is declared on the next line.

secret setting of hawep-yahig: LEDGER_TOKEN29=41b5d6315371c92885eaeb077fb63

Subject: Customer-concentration risk — action for branches

Team,

Our review shows that one account, the Tarrowgate Group, now represents 38% of total revenue, up from 24% last year. This exposure is unacceptable over the medium term. Branch managers should prioritise pipeline diversification: each branch is asked to identify three mid-size prospects by quarter-end. Central marketing will support with the new Fernvale campaign assets. Detailed targets follow next week. The confidential item below explains the underlying strategic reason.

board note of baweg-bawig: Project Tamath slips by six weeks because of the audit delay.

INTERNAL MEMO — Divestiture of the Halloway Instruments Unit

To the incoming director: the sale of Halloway Instruments to Pellstone Group is in final diligence. Closing is targeted for the end of next quarter. Transition services cover IT, payroll, and logistics for nine months. Forty-two employees transfer; six remain with us in the Dunmere facility. Customer notifications go out after signing, not before. Your role is to steady the remaining product lines. First, read the restricted note below.

internal memo for kawip-hadug: Headcount on the Wenwyn team goes from 7 to 140 by the end of January. Gross margin on Wenwyn came in at 20 percent against a plan of 15 percent.

Document Transport — Print Shop Master Copies

Quick guide for moving master copies to Bramblehurst Print Co. These are the only originals, so treat the run like a valuables transfer, not a regular parcel drop. Use the red tamper-evident envelopes from the supply shelf, log the seal number in the transport book, and never combine the run with general mail. The masters go directly to the press supervisor, nobody else. On arrival, the courier must follow the hand-over instruction stated below.

drop instructions, kajep-tageg: the kasvan casdor courier leaves the quenvan quenox druox ledger at gate 4316 under passcode 799004